Frequently Asked Questions about Hawthorne
How much are Studio apartments in Hawthorne?
There are currently 1,775 Studio Apartments in Hawthorne with rent ranges from $1,295 to $3,150 with an average price of $2,086.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Hawthorne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Hawthorne ranges from $1,500 to $3,844 with an average monthly rent of $2,487.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Hawthorne c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Hawthorne range from $1,500 to $4,779.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,953.
How expensive are Hawthorne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 733 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Hawthorne on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,221 to $5,349 - averaging $3,436 for the location.
